Focus on Early Transcendentals Approach
The "Early Transcendentals" format introduces transcendental functions—such as
exponential, logarithmic, and trigonometric functions—early in the course. This approach
allows students to explore these functions in conjunction with differential and integral
calculus, providing a more integrated understanding of the subject matter.

Key Topics Covered in Stewart Calculus Early Transcendentals
9th Edition
Functions, Graphs, and Limits
The beginning chapters focus on understanding the foundational concepts:
Understanding functions and their properties
Graphing techniques and analyzing function behavior
Limit definitions, techniques for calculating limits, and their importance in calculus
Continuity and the Intermediate Value Theorem
Differentiation and Applications
This section delves into the core of calculus:
Rules of differentiation, including product, quotient, and chain rule
Implicit differentiation and higher-order derivatives
Applications such as optimization, related rates, and motion analysis
Graphing using derivatives: increasing/decreasing functions, concavity, and points
of inflection
Transcendental Functions
As the course adopts the early transcentals approach, this part covers:
Exponential and logarithmic functions
Trigonometric functions and their inverses
Hyperbolic functions and their properties
Derivatives of all these functions with real-world applications
Integration Techniques and Applications
The textbook emphasizes understanding integration as the inverse of differentiation:
Antiderivatives and indefinite integrals
Definite integrals and the Fundamental Theorem of Calculus
Techniques such as substitution, integration by parts, partial fractions, and
trigonometric substitution
Applications including area, volume, arc length, and surface area
3
Advanced Topics and Series
In later chapters, the focus shifts to more advanced concepts:
Sequences and series, including convergence tests
Powers series and Taylor series
Parametric equations and polar coordinates
Vector functions and multivariable calculus fundamentals

Potential Limitations and Criticisms
Density of Content
Some educators and students find the volume of material and the density of explanations
overwhelming, especially for beginners. The extensive scope may lead to a steep learning
curve if not paced appropriately.
Complexity for First-Time Learners
While the early introduction of transcendental functions is pedagogically advantageous, it
can also be challenging for students who lack a strong algebraic or analytical foundation.
Supplemental instruction may be necessary for some learners.
Cost and Accessibility
As with many textbooks, Stewart Calculus 9th Edition can be expensive, potentially
limiting access for some students. The reliance on supplementary online resources may
also pose barriers if institutional access is restricted.
Balance Between Rigor and Intuition
Although Stewart aims for a balance, some critics argue that the book prioritizes
computational techniques over rigorous proofs, which might not satisfy students seeking a
purely theoretical perspective. Conversely, others may find the explanations insufficiently
rigorous at higher levels.
